#0fb5fb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0fb5fb is composed of 5.9% red, 71% green and 98.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94% cyan, 27.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 197.8 degrees, a saturation of 96.7% and a lightness of 52.2%. #0fb5fb color hex could be obtained by blending #1effff with #006bf7. Closest websafe color is: #00ccff.

#0fb5fb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#0fb5fb has RGB values of R:15, G:181, B:251 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0.28,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 1029627.

Hex triplet 0fb5fb #0fb5fb
RGB Decimal 15, 181, 251 rgb(15,181,251)
RGB Percent 5.9, 71, 98.4 rgb(5.9%,71%,98.4%)
CMYK 94, 28, 0, 2
HSL 197.8°, 96.7, 52.2 hsl(197.8,96.7%,52.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 197.8°, 94, 98.4
Web Safe 00ccff #00ccff
CIE-LAB 69.549, -13.359, -45.08
XYZ 34.129, 40.111, 97.205
xyY 0.199, 0.234, 40.111
CIE-LCH 69.549, 47.018, 253.493
CIE-LUV 69.549, -45.784, -71.499
Hunter-Lab 63.333, -14.643, -46.666
Binary 00001111, 10110101, 11111011

Shades and Tints of #0fb5fb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00080b is the darkest color, while #f7fcff is the lightest one.
